Web Development Career Path: Everything you need to know
Web Development Career Path: Everything you need to know
A web development career involves designing, building, and maintaining websites and web applications. Professionals in this field learn coding languages, frameworks, and development tools to create functional and user-friendly websites. With the right web development course and practical training, learners can start careers as front-end, back-end, or full-stack developers.

What Is Web Development?
Web development refers to the process of creating websites and web applications for the internet. It includes coding, database management, design implementation, and performance optimization. A structured web development course helps learners understand programming languages, frameworks, and development tools needed to build modern websites.
The web development course focuses on both technical functionality and user experience. Developers write code that determines how a website behaves, loads, and interacts with users.
Main Areas of Web Development
- Front-End Development
Front-end development handles the visual part of a website that users interact with. Developers use HTML, CSS, and JavaScript to design layouts, navigation, and responsive interfaces that work smoothly on mobile and desktop devices. - Back-End Development
Back-end development manages server operations, databases, and application logic. Technologies such as Node.js, Python, and PHP process user requests, manage data storage, and ensure that website features function correctly. - Full-Stack Development
Full-stack developers manage both front-end and back-end tasks. Their skills allow them to build complete applications from interface design to server management and database integration.
Skills Required for a Web Development Career
A successful web developer needs programming knowledge, logical thinking, and practical development experience. Learning coding languages, frameworks, and development tools helps professionals build functional websites. Structured training through a web development course provides technical knowledge along with hands-on project experience.
Important Skills to Learn
- Programming Languages
HTML forms the structure of websites, CSS manages design and layout, and JavaScript controls interaction and dynamic features. These languages form the foundation of modern website development. - Frameworks and Libraries
Frameworks simplify development by providing ready-made components and structured coding methods. React, Angular, and Vue help build interactive interfaces efficiently. - Database Management
Web applications store user data, content, and transaction records in databases. Learning SQL and database tools helps developers manage and retrieve data securely. - Version Control Systems
Version control tools help track code changes and support collaboration among development teams. Git and GitHub allow developers to maintain code history and work on projects efficiently.
Career Opportunities in Web Development
The web development industry offers multiple career paths across technology companies, startups, and freelance markets. Developers can specialize in front-end, back-end, or full-stack development depending on their skills and interests. Completing a web development course helps learners prepare for these professional roles.
Common Career Roles
- Front-End Developer
This role focuses on building user interfaces that visitors interact with directly. Developers create responsive layouts, manage website animations, and ensure smooth navigation across devices. - Back-End Developer
Back-end developers manage application logic, database operations, and server communication. Their work ensures that website features such as login systems, data storage, and APIs operate correctly. - Full-Stack Developer
Full-stack developers handle both interface design and server-side programming. Their knowledge allows them to build complete applications and manage development projects independently. - Freelance Web Developer
Freelancers develop websites for clients, businesses, and startups. This career path provides flexibility and opportunities to work on diverse projects across industries.
Learning Web Development Through Professional Training
Professional training programs help learners gain structured knowledge, practical coding experience, and industry-relevant skills. Institutes offering the best institute for web development course in Jaipur focus on project-based learning, mentorship, and modern development tools to prepare students for real-world web development careers.
Developers benefit from guided learning environments where concepts are explained step by step. Practical projects help learners understand how websites are built from start to finish.
In Jaipur, Navigo Academy provides structured technical training designed for beginners and aspiring developers. Students searching for the best institute for a web development course in Jaipur often consider programs that include real-world projects, expert mentorship, and portfolio development opportunities that prepare learners for industry roles.
Who Should Choose a Web Development Career?
A web development career suits individuals interested in technology, coding, and digital innovation. This field offers opportunities for beginners, career switchers, and students who want stable and skill-based professions. A web development course helps build practical abilities needed for modern digital industries.
Suitable for the Following Learners
- Students Interested in Technology Careers
Students who enjoy coding, logical problem solving, and digital creativity can build strong careers in web development. Learning programming languages early helps develop technical confidence and career readiness. - Career Switchers Seeking Digital Skills
Professionals from non-technical backgrounds can enter the technology industry through structured web development training. Skill-based learning programs help them transition into high-demand digital roles. - Freelancers and Entrepreneurs
Business owners and freelancers benefit from understanding how websites work. Web development knowledge helps them manage online platforms, digital products, and web-based services independently. - Digital Marketing Professionals
Marketing specialists who understand web technologies can optimize websites, landing pages, and campaign performance more effectively.
How to Choose the Right Web Development Course
Choosing the right course requires evaluating curriculum quality, instructor experience, practical training, and career support. Structured programs that focus on real projects and modern technologies help learners gain practical coding skills and industry knowledge needed for professional web development roles.
Step-by-Step Decision Guide
- Check the Curriculum Structure
The course should cover HTML, CSS, JavaScript, frameworks, databases, and deployment. A balanced curriculum ensures learners understand both front-end and back-end development fundamentals. - Evaluate Practical Project Training
Hands-on projects help students apply theoretical concepts. Building websites and web applications improves coding confidence and prepares learners for real-world development tasks. - Review Instructor Experience
Learning from experienced mentors helps students understand development workflows, debugging techniques, and industry practices. - Look for Portfolio Development Opportunities
A strong portfolio demonstrates coding ability to employers. Institutes that include portfolio projects give students practical proof of their skills. - Check Placement or Career Guidance Support
Career support, such as interview preparation, resume guidance, and internship opportunities, helps learners enter the job market confidently.
Factors That Influence Web Development Course Fees
Course pricing depends on training duration, curriculum depth, project work, and mentorship quality. Institutes offering industry-oriented training with hands-on projects may have higher fees, but the value comes from practical learning, career preparation, and professional development support.
Key Pricing Factors
|
Factor |
Impact on Price |
|
Course Duration |
Longer programs with deeper training generally cost more due to extended learning time |
|
Practical Projects |
Courses with real project work require mentoring and evaluation resources |
|
Trainer Expertise |
Experienced instructors often increase program value and pricing |
| Career Support |
Placement training and job assistance services add additional value |
Programs focusing on hands-on development and career readiness often provide better long-term value for students.
Conclusion
A web development career offers strong opportunities in the digital economy. Structured learning, practical coding experience, and project-based training help individuals build professional skills. Choosing a high-quality web development course and consistent practice can lead to rewarding roles in technology, startups, and freelance markets.
FAQs
What skills are required for a web development career?
A web developer needs programming knowledge, problem-solving ability, and familiarity with development tools. Skills in HTML, CSS, JavaScript, frameworks, and database management help professionals create interactive websites and web applications. Practical experience through projects strengthens coding confidence and prepares learners for real-world development tasks.
How long does it take to learn web development?
Learning duration depends on the course structure and practice time. Beginner programs may take several months to cover programming fundamentals, frameworks, and project work. Continuous coding practice, real projects, and mentorship help learners develop stronger development skills and build professional portfolios.
Is web development a good career choice?
Technology companies, startups, and online businesses depend heavily on websites and web applications. This creates consistent demand for skilled developers. A well-structured web development course helps learners gain technical abilities that support stable and growth-oriented technology careers.
How difficult is web development for beginners?
Beginners may find coding challenging at the start, but structured learning simplifies the process. Step-by-step training, practice exercises, and real projects help students gradually build confidence. Consistent practice and guidance from experienced mentors improve learning outcomes.
Can web developers work as freelancers?
Many developers work independently and build websites for businesses and startups. Freelancing allows professionals to work on diverse projects, build client networks, and earn income through remote opportunities. Strong technical skills and a well-built project portfolio support freelance success.
Recent Posts
What is Technical SEO and Why It Is Important for Your Website
Digital Marketing vs Web Development: Which Career Has a Better Future in India?
Python vs JavaScript vs PHP – Which Web Development Language is Better in 2026?